The Nobel Prize is a set of annual international awards that recognizes outstanding achievements in various fields. The awards are named after Alfred Nobel, the inventor of dynamite, who left a bequest to fund the prizes after his death. The Nobel Prize is widely regarded as the most prestigious award in the world.

The Nobel Prizes are awarded annually in six categories - Physics, Chemistry, Medicine or Physiology, Literature, Peace, and Economic Sciences. The Nobel Prize in Economic Sciences is not one of the original five categories established by Nobel, but was instituted by the Swedish Central Bank in 1968.

The Nobel Prize winners are chosen by various committees in Sweden and Norway, depending on the category. The committees are made up of experts in the relevant field who are appointed by the respective academies.

To be eligible for the Nobel Prize, an individual or a group should have made a significant contribution to the respective field. The contributions could be in the form of discoveries, inventions, research, or advocacy. The nominations for the Nobel Prize are invited from individuals and organizations such as universities, previous Nobel Prize winners, and various other qualified persons.

The Nobel Prize consists of a diploma, a gold medal, and a cash prize. The amount of cash prize varies from year to year and category to category, but is usually several million Swedish kronor.

Over the years, many prominent personalities from around the world have been conferred with the Nobel Prize for their exceptional contributions to their respective fields. Some of the notable recipients of the Nobel Prize include Albert Einstein (Physics), Marie Curie (Chemistry and Physics), Martin Luther King Jr. (Peace), and Malala Yousafzai (Peace).
